From a tourney players point of view radiate is the worst, convoke is a t least good in draft. Transmute is pretty good, but obviously as everyone has seen this ext ptq season, dredge is the strongest, ugh.

Actually, I like Selesnya as of now... but that's only because I have Doubling Season and 4 copies of Scatter the Seeds.

That's 12 tokens, and not to mention 2 for each time Guildmage hits.

Kickass strategy : Token Army, Veteran Armor, Scion of the Wild, Rally the Righteous.

Veteran Armorer prevents the sweeps of 1 damage to your tokens, Scion of the Wild gets +1/+1 for each token and creature you have, Rally the Righteous is selfexplanitory...

Oh, Hour of Reckoning... that card is *gargle* why convoke is sometimes worth it.
